Welcome to the pwa-review-skill project! This tool helps you perform a detailed audit of your Progressive Web Apps (PWAs). It goes beyond traditional tools like Lighthouse and provides insights into iOS compatibility, safe areas, touch events, and advanced PWA features.

Here are some key features of the pwa-review-skill:
- 160-Point Audit: A thorough analysis of your PWA across various performance metrics.
- iOS Compatibility Checks: Ensure your app works seamlessly on iOS devices.
- Safe Area Assessment: Make sure your app looks good on different screen sizes and orientations.
- Touch Event Analysis: Check how well your app responds to user interaction.
- Report Generation: Receive easy-to-read reports to help you improve your app.
After installation, follow these steps to perform an audit:
- Open the pwa-review-skill application.
- Enter the URL of the PWA you want to audit.
- Click the "Start Audit" button.
- Wait for the analysis to complete. This might take a few minutes.
- Review the results and suggestions provided in the report. You can export this report for your reference.
The audit report contains various sections, including:
- Performance Scores: Overall score based on speed, usability, and SEO.
- Actionable Insights: Specific areas where you can improve your app.
- Compare with Standards: See how your PWA stacks up against common benchmarks.
